Flow Efficiency

50
©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is Flow Efficieny Eurolab - Aachen, Sept. 2013

description

Introducing the Lean concept of "Flow" and other meanings for a Knowledge-Based Company. Talk delivered at Eurolab, September 2013

Transcript of Flow Efficiency

Page 1: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Flow EfficienyEurolab - Aachen, Sept. 2013

Page 2: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Angel Medinilla

Let’s make a couple

of changes here!

[email protected]/en/AngelMedinilla(Slides, Videos, Newsletter, Books, Blog, LinkedIn, Sketchnotes, Twitter...)

Twitter: @angel_m (would love some instant feedback!)

Page 3: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 4: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 5: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 6: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 7: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 8: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 9: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 10: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 11: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

My Pleasure!

Page 12: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

“Flow”

Page 13: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 14: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 15: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 16: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 17: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Coding

Meeting!

Coding Coding Coding Coding

Need resource! Urgent need! NeedInfo

Distracted

Page 18: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Coding

Meeting!

Coding Coding Coding Coding

Need resource! Urgent need! NeedInfo

Distracted

Snap! Snap! Snap!Snap!

Snap!

Page 19: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Coding

Meeting!

Coding Coding Coding Coding

Need resource! Urgent need! NeedInfo

Distracted

Snap! Snap! Snap!Snap!

Snap!

Page 20: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Coding

Meeting!

CodingCoding Coding Coding

Need resource!

Urgent need! NeedInfo

Distracted

Page 21: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Coding

Meeting!

CodingCoding Coding Coding

Need resource!

Urgent need! NeedInfo

Distracted

40% Efficiency

Page 22: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Coding

Meeting!

CodingCoding Coding Coding

Need resource!

Urgent need! NeedInfo

Distracted

40% Efficiency

(reduce another 20-40% if you are context-switching)

Page 23: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Week 1 Week 2 Week 3 Week 4

WIP: 1Time to market (MVP): 1 week

Cycle Time: 1 weekLead Time: 2.5 weeks

Page 24: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Week 4

WIP: 4Time to market (MVP): 4 weeks

Cycle Time: 4 weeksLead Time: 4 weeks

(+ context switching delay)

Page 25: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Team “Flow”

Week 4

WIP: 4Time to market (MVP): 4 weeks

Cycle Time: 4 weeksLead Time: 4 weeks

(+ context switching delay)

Page 26: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

“Busyness”

Page 27: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

(let’s go back to “Flow”)

Page 28: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Page 29: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

KaizenKaizen

Page 30: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Maximize ValueOptimize Stream

Kaizen

Flow

KaizenKaizen

Pull

Page 31: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Maximize ValueOptimize Stream

Kaizen

Flow

KaizenKaizen

Pull

Long Term Thinking Inspect and Adapt

Develop & EmpowerRight Process

Leadership & Culture Go & See

Teamwork

See the wholeEliminate Waste

Consensus & Fast action

Page 32: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Value & Waste

Page 33: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Value Stream Map

Page 34: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Value Stream Map

Page 35: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Real Exercise - VSM + Lead Time

Page 36: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Scrum

“Waterfallity Rate”

Page 37: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Optimize Value Stream: Theory of Constraints

Page 38: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

“One Piece Flow”

Page 39: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Batch Producing vs. One Piece FlowB B B B B

B B B B C C C C

3 min. 12 min.

10 min 10 min 10 min

- “Produce one, deliver one” (zero inventory)- Continuous Integration / Continuous Delivery

Little’s Law: Cycle time grows with the amount of items being processed ( L = λW, number of customer = arrival rate x average time spent)

Cycle Time = Lead Time = 30 minutes)

Cycle Tyme = 3 minutes; Lead Time = 12 minutes;

Page 40: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Silos & flow - SuboptimizationSelected Backlog

Code Test Done!

Design

Rdy Rdy On On

Page 41: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Dissatisfaction!

Page 42: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Did he say “continuous delivery”?

Page 43: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Single Minute Exchange of Die (SMED)

Page 44: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Single Minute Exchange of Die (SMED)

36 hours --> 10 Hours ---> 10 Minutes!

3 months --> 25 Days ---> 10 hours???

Page 45: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

WikiSpeed

Page 46: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

2011 !!!

Page 47: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

The Agile Fluency Model

Page 48: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Wrap Up!1) Protect Developer Flow - avoid Context Switching2) Maximize value by erradicating waste3) Map and optimize the Value Stream; watch your waterfallity rate4) Help your system flow - work on small batches, deliver continuously, reduce both cycle time AND lead time6) Develop your SMED in order to make the system flow7) Progress in your Agile Fluency8) Think BEYOND!

Page 49: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

Thank you and... BLOG IT!!

(Oh, yes, and buy the book!)http://www.proyectalis.com/en/AngelMedinilla

Page 50: Flow Efficiency

© 2013 Proyectalis Gestión de Proyectos S.L. More at http://Slideshare.net/proyectalis

http://creativecommons.org/licenses/by-nc-nd/3.0/

This presentation is based upon the ideas and work of many people. And while I’ve tried to recognize copyrights and give credit and attribution where possible, I cannot possibly list them all, so if you feel like there’s something that should be added, changed or removed from this presentation, please drop me an e-mail at [email protected]